2012-01-06 07:57:46 +0000 2012-01-06 07:57:46 +0000
8
8
Advertisement

Suppression des lignes non désirées dans une feuille de calcul Excel

Advertisement

Dans un fichier Excel 2010, il y a environ 100 lignes contenant des données, mais la feuille de travail entière affiche 1048576 lignes vides (ce qui fait que le fichier fait environ 2,5 mb). Je dois supprimer les lignes vides après les données. Mais sélectionner la ligne et la supprimer ne fait rien. Comment supprimer ces lignes non désirées ?

Ceci est mon fichier excel http://www.mediafire.com/download.php?au957fcnh3odbcd

Quelqu'un peut-il m'expliquer ce qui ne va pas avec ce fichier ?

Advertisement
Advertisement

Réponses (9)

9
9
9
2012-01-06 14:11:44 +0000

Il y a certainement quelque chose qui ne va pas dans votre dossier. Il pourrait être plus facile de copier les 100 lignes que vous souhaitez conserver dans un nouveau fichier de classeur plutôt que d'essayer de effacer un million de lignes.

Une recherche de doublons dans l'ensemble du document a permis de trouver et de supprimer plus d'un million de doublons. Il y a donc des caractères cachés ou quelque chose qui occupe de l'espace dans ce classeur. Cela n'a toujours pas aidé car la taille de sauvegarde est passée ensuite à 35 Mo.

Solution: Une fois que j'ai copié les lignes que vous avez remplies dans un nouveau classeur, la taille du fichier sauvegardé n'est plus que de 10K.

5
5
5
2012-01-06 08:04:47 +0000

Sélectionnez les lignes que vous souhaitez supprimer. Si vous avez l'Office 2003 : http://www.mrexcel.com/archive/Edit/4259.html

2007 et plus tard : dans le ruban au démarrage, il y a le bouton supprimer (bloc appelé cellules), cliquez sur la petite flèche en dessous et choisissez supprimer des lignes.

4
Advertisement
4
4
2017-03-17 21:17:41 +0000
Advertisement

Le commentateur du post de Robert est en plein dans le mille. Après avoir supprimé les lignes indésirables, vous devez enregistrer le classeur, le fermer, puis le rouvrir.

Microsoft décrit les étapes dans son article “Comment réinitialiser la dernière cellule dans Excel” . Ils mentionnent également l'étape “Sauvegarder”, mais j'aimerais qu'ils lui accordent plus d'importance. Tant que vous n'avez pas sauvegardé et rouvert le classeur, il semble que votre suppression n'ait rien donné !

Copier les bonnes lignes dans un nouveau classeur est également une bonne solution, surtout si vous n'avez pas à vous soucier des macros ou des formules avec des références de cellules compliquées.

1
1
1
2016-07-12 07:19:50 +0000

Une autre cause peut être qu'une ou plusieurs colonnes de la feuille de calcul sont référencées dans une formule d'une autre feuille de calcul sans préciser le nombre de lignes.

0
Advertisement
0
0
2013-04-05 15:35:48 +0000
Advertisement

La meilleure option est d'utiliser ctrl+maj + flèche vers le bas pour cacher les lignes non désirées et ctrl+maj + flèche vers la droite pour cacher les colonnes non désirées

0
0
0
2019-01-23 16:35:30 +0000

J'ai trouvé la solution,

1) Vous devez supprimer tout ce qui se trouve sur ces lignes vides, donc cliquez sur la première ligne empy (après toutes vos données) et ensuite cliquez sur CTRL+Maj et la flèche vers le bas. C'est ainsi que vous sélectionnez tout ce qui se trouve en bas.

2) Dans le panneau HOME à la section EDITING, cliquez sur Clear>Clear all

3) puis cliquez sur style : Normal (sans cela, ça n'a pas marché pour moi)

4) et ensuite vous devez activer ce module complémentaire (tutoriel copié depuis le support ms) :

Click File > Options > Add-Ins.

Make sure COM Add-ins is selected in the Manage box, and click Go.
Manage COM Add-ins

In the COM Add-Ins box, check Inquire, and then click OK.
The Inquire tab should now be visible in the ribbon.

Important : Vous pouvez faire une copie de sauvegarde de votre fichier avant de nettoyer l'excès de formatage des cellules, car dans certains cas ce processus peut faire augmenter la taille de votre fichier, et il n'y a aucun moyen d'annuler le changement.

Pour supprimer l'excès de formatage dans la feuille de calcul actuelle, procédez comme suit :

On the Inquire tab, click Clean Excess Cell Formatting.

https://support.office.com/en-us/article/clean-excess-cell-formatting-on-a-worksheet-e744c248-6925-4e77-9d49-4874f7474738

Cela devrait nettoyer vos lignes supplémentaires.

0
Advertisement
0
0
2015-02-04 19:25:25 +0000
Advertisement

J'avais le même problème et j'ai trouvé un moyen de le résoudre qui a fonctionné à quelques reprises pour moi.

Assurez-vous que vous n'avez pas de formatage descendant dans ces colonnes (par exemple, des bordures de cellules appliquées à une colonne entière). Attrapez la barre de défilement et faites-la glisser jusqu'en bas. Sélectionnez la ligne du bas (1048579, je crois) et un tas au-dessus, environ 20-30, tout ce qui est visible à l'écran. Faites un clic droit sur la zone d'en-tête de la rangée et cliquez sur Delete. Faites glisser la barre de défilement vers le haut et sélectionnez une cellule où se trouvent vos données. Sélectionnez une autre feuille de calcul, puis revenez en arrière. Elle devrait être corrigée.

0
0
0
2019-01-03 12:40:32 +0000

Comment supprimer des lignes et des colonnes indésirables dans une feuille Excel

(Cela ne prendra pas autant de temps qu'un premier coup d'œil pourrait le suggérer et c'est sans danger !)

Il y a deux feuilles auxquelles il est fait référence dans la procédure ci-dessous.

Appelons votre feuille originale YourOriginalSheet (elle représente le nom réel de votre feuille originale).

Appelons l'autre feuille ShortSheet, qui contiendra une copie des seules cellules pertinentes.

(1) Dans YourOriginalSheet, Select et Copy l'éventail des cellules pertinentes (ne collez pas encore).

(2) Ajoutez une nouvelle feuille nommée ShortSheet, placez le curseur dans la cellule représentant le coin supérieur gauche de la plage à copier (probablement A1), et collez comme ceci :

(2a) Paste Special... > Formulas [clic droit sur la cellule du coin supérieur gauche]

(2b) Paste Special... > Values

(2c) Paste Special... > Formats

(2d) Paste Special... > Column Widths

(2e) Inclure d'autres options Paste Special qui, selon vous, pourraient aider à améliorer l'aspect de la feuille.

(3) Appuyez sur Ctrl-Shift-End pour trouver le coin inférieur droit de ShortSheet afin de vous assurer qu'il contient toutes les données pertinentes.

(4) Save le cahier de travail. (Save As ... un nouveau fichier si vous voulez une sauvegarde.)

(5) Effacer YourOriginalSheet (Les données pertinentes sont actuellement sauvegardées dans ShortSheet.)

(6) Renommer ShortSheet au nom réel de votre feuille originale`.

Nothing has changed except to make the workbook a lot smaller, so all macros, external references to this worksheet, etc. should still work.


Here is a macro to accomplish the steps in (2).

0x1&

Before using the macro, Select and Copy the relevant range, as was done in step (1).

I saved my macro in my Personal.xlsb workbook for future use everywhere and assigned keypress Ctrl + Shift + V.

0
Advertisement
0
0
2019-04-09 13:21:32 +0000
Advertisement

Le secret consiste à supprimer les lignes, à sauvegarder la feuille de calcul et à la fermer. Lorsque vous rouvrez le fichier, il sera plus petit. Dans mon cas, j'ai eu des problèmes avec plusieurs feuilles de calcul du classeur.

Advertisement

Questions connexes

6
13
9
10
5
Advertisement
Advertisement